HOME | CAR NEWS | CAR REVIEWS | RACING | AUTO SHOWS | VIDEOS | COLLECTOR | SUBSCRIBE | | | Formula One broadcast rights in the U.S. had resided with the Speed television network for the past 17 years.... | | NBC Sports Group signed a four-year deal with Formula One for the exclusive U.S. media rights to the world's most popular global motorsports series. The deal, which begins next season, will provide over 100 hours of programming across NBC and cable channel NBC Sports Network. Jon Miller, president of programming for NBC Sports and NBC ... |

|  | | Toyota claimed a second FIA World Endurance Championship victory in five attempts in a thrilling battle with Audi at Fuji in Japan. Alex Wurz, Nicolas Lapierre and Kazuki Nakajima took the win aboard their TS030 HYBRID at the end of six hours of racing by just 11 seconds. They beat the Audi R18 e-...
